Novel building ergonomic support device
Technical field
The utility model is related to construction engineering technical fields, are specially a kind of novel building ergonomic support device.
Background technology
Architectural engineering support device be it is a kind of for architectural engineering carry out Auxiliary support to prevent the equipment collapsed, each It is widely used in kind architectural engineering, especially it is important to be embodied when carrying out other component installation in of short duration support Effect.
And traditional architectural engineering support device usually requires substantial amounts of support tube and is supported, so needing the plenty of time Assembled, time-consuming and laborious and recycling is inconvenient, support tube height be it is certain cannot carry out the adjusting of height, so having certain Limitation.

In use, support tube 1 is placed on the suitable position at construction, the fixed supporting block in bottom of support tube 1 14 contact with construction ground because supporting block 14 and the contact area on ground are big, supporting block 14 to the support of support tube 1 more Add firm;After supporting block 14 is contacted with ground, 1 top of support tube contacts support with building;
When 1 in-position of support tube is improper, because support tube 1 reaches insufficient height, support can not be played Effect rotates height regulation handle 20, and height regulation handle 20 drives height regulating rod 18 to rotate, and height regulating rod 18 rotates band The dynamic turbine 19 that adjusts rotates, and adjusts 19 engagement in rotation of turbine and adjusts worm screw 17, rotates adjusting worm screw 17, adjusts worm screw 17 and rotates Adjusting slider 16 is engaged, so as to which the adjusting slider 16 at 14 both ends of supporting block be moved to centre position, because adjusting slider 16 is Right-angled trapezium, the inclined side of adjusting slider 16 are contacted with the sliding slot 15 of adjusting slider 16, and the upper bottom of adjusting slider 16 passes through adjusting 17 screw thread of worm screw engages, so when the adjusting slider 16 at 14 both ends of supporting block is moved along sliding slot 15, the bevel edge of adjusting slider 16 Supporting block 14 is supported upwards, so as to raise the height of supporting block 14, then moves up support tube 1, so that support Pipe 1 reaches suitable position and plays a supporting role;
After support tube 1 plays a supportive role because adjusting slider 16 raises supporting block 14, only adjusting slider 16 with Bottom surface contacts so contact area is reduced, so by adjusting 26 screw thread installation and adjustment screw rod of threaded hole so as to playing a supportive role;
After the arrival suitable position of support tube 1 plays a supportive role, rotary motion handle 13 makes swing handle 13 drive support Adjusting rod 11 rotates, and the rotation of support adjusting rod 11 rotates cone of support tooth 12,12 screw thread elongate support screw rod 10 of cone of support tooth, Studdle 10 is made to rotate, studdle 10, which rotates, drives support slipper 7 to move up, and support slipper 7 is in support tube 1 Cooperation is slided, and will not be shaken, and when sliding support sliding block 7 moves up, the strut 9 that 7 side wall of support slipper rotates is in notch 8 Place rotates, and strut 9 is supported support plate 4, and support plate 4 is unfolded from the side-walls of support plate 4,4 expansion of support plate After play a supportive role, the position of notch 8 is corresponded with the slideway 2 on support tube 1 to be coordinated;
After the expansion of support plate 4 plays a supportive role, pawl 24 is slided to the left, makes what the left end of pawl 24 was threadedly coupled to hold out against Bolt 25 carries out thread fitting with the threaded hole 23 in slide 22, and so as to which pawl 24 be fixed, pawl 24 connects with ratchet 21 It touches, pawl 24 by after fixation, by pawl 24 fixed by ratchet 21, so that support adjusting rod 11 is fixed, will not reverse Support slipper 7 is caused to glide, support plate 4 is made not stress support;
Support plate 4 upon deployment, also can be gradually unfolded in the protection network 6 that support plate 4 covers, when the whole exhibitions of support plate 4 After opening supporting role, protection network 6 is also extended to suitable position, so that protection network 6 is complete by the bearing area of support plate 4 Portion covers, and when supporting surface has cast, cast can be fallen into protection network 6, avoids and directly falls to ground and cause accident;
Support plate 4 is unfolded on support tube 1 after support, because the increase of bearing area, the support tube 1 of needs Quantity tails off, and makes Construction of Supporting more efficient;
After support is completed, make 12 elongate support screw rod 10 of cone of support tooth will branch by rotating adjusting support tube 1 again Support sliding block 7, which moves down, recycles support plate 4, and recycling is more convenient quick, rotates height regulating rod 18 by two adjustings Sliding block 16 slides in and out, and makes the height of supporting block 14 reduce, and support tube 1 is made highly to reduce, and support tube 1 is made to be easier to be fetched.
